Most ML work fails at the handover, not the modelling. A notebook that scores well offline is not a system: it has no feature contract, no serving path, no way to tell when the world moved underneath it. We build the part that makes a model an operational asset rather than a demo.

What the work involves
Training & feature pipelines
- Reproducible training pipelines with versioned data and parameters
- Feature engineering with a shared definition across training and serving
- Experiment tracking so a result can be re-derived months later
Serving & integration
- Batch scoring and real-time inference endpoints
- Latency, throughput, and cost budgets set before the model ships
- Graceful degradation paths for when inference is slow or unavailable
Monitoring & lifecycle
- Data and prediction drift detection with alerting
- Scheduled and triggered retraining with promotion gates
- Shadow deployment and champion/challenger evaluation in production
